The importance of Morgans earlier work with Drosophila was that it demonstrated that the associations known as coupling and repulsion, discovered by English workers in 1909 and 1910 using the Sweet Pea, are in reality the obverse and reverse of the same phenomenon, which was later called linkage. The ability of a droplet to retain equilibrium on an inclined surface is known as the contact angle hysteresis (CAH) phenomenon which results from the presence of an energy barrier at the front of the droplet.
